AGM
We held our Senior and Minor Board AGM on Saturday via Microsoft Teams and it was well attended. Despite the exceptional challenges of the last year, Castledaly GAA has shown progress both off and on the pitch, as recognised in the reports from committee and treasurer. A strong vote of confidence in the outgoing committee saw re-election of all who went forward again.
Chairman Joe Sheerin welcomed Tom Stone as new vice-Chairman;
Denis Fannin continues as secretary with Enda Kenny as assistant; Paula Finan and Jack Higgins remain as club treasurers; and PRO Dermot Walshe is joined by John Warburton.
Minor Chairman Paul Higgins and Minor Secretary Richard Dolan confirming the Minor committee remains unchanged for 2021.
The chairman applauded the work of the executive, the trainers, mentors, players, and supporters in a busy calendar in 2020. Plans are already under way for 2021 with great excitement and energy, especially in new developments.
The AGM finished by voicing its sympathies and condolences to everyone who has lost loved ones since January 2020.
